    About Cutoff at SIES Mumbai

    SIES College of Management Studies, Navi Mumbai releases the cutoff for admission to the M.M.S programme. The SIES Mumbai cutoff refers to the merit score required by the candidates to qualify for the SIES Mumbai M.M.S admission process. SIES College of Management Studies cutoff is released after the declaration of the MAH CET result. Based on the candidate’s merit score, SIES College of Management Studies, Navi Mumbai prepares the final merit list. The factors affecting the SIES Mumbai cutoff are the number of qualifying candidates, the number of candidates who appeared in the entrance test, the total number of seats, the difficulty level of the entrance test, marking scheme, reservation criteria and past year cut off trends. Candidates who meet the SIESCOMS Mumbai cutoff are eligible to participate in the Maharashtra CAP All India Counselling.

    How is the SIES AIMA PGDM programme for fresher's? placement stats ?

    SIES AIMA PGDM programme for is a decent option for freshers. As per their official records they have been able to place 95 to 100 percent of their students. Their latest placement statistics -


    PGDM / MMS /AIMA-PGDM Batch 2017-19

    Total No. of Students - 288

    No. of Companies that visited campus- 135

    New Companies - 43

    Highest Salary - Rs. 18.00 Lakhs p.a

    Average Salary Rs. 7.14 Lakhs p.a


    Summer Internship stats PGDM/ MMS Batch 2018-20

    Total No. of Students - 239

    No. of Companies that visited campus - 103

    Highest Stipend - Rs. 70K

    Average Stipend - Rs. 20K

    i got 59.45 in cat how many chances are there for me in sies

    With your CMAT percentile you can some chances of getting a call from SIES Mumbai only if you belong to Maharashtra as they do a profile based shortlisting for students from Maharashtra. For other state students the minimum percentile you need to get in CMAT is 99.94. Moreover out of 120 seats only 5 seats are there for other state students. So if you belong to Maharashtra you can get a call or else the chances would be bleak.
